ES6拓展符修对象

// ES6 拓展符合并两个对象
let ab = { ...a, ...b }; // 等同于 let ab = Object.assign({}, a, b);

// 修改对象部分属性。用户自定义的属性,放在扩展运算符后面,则扩展运算符内部的同名属性会被覆盖掉

let aWithOverrides = { ...a, x: 1, y: 2 };
let obj = {
  ..origin,
  name:"winyh"
}

  

猜你喜欢

转载自www.cnblogs.com/winyh/p/10930375.html